Output ed8610651575cc38ca9e53dcff490d3b71112f778a4b66f69f00e9f9ae6a0ee0:1

value
6943320843594
script pubkey
OP_0 OP_PUSHBYTES_20 ae6be9a2de035ec84a2518d38c7903a1f7a2d550
address
tb1q4e47ngk7qd0vsj39rrfcc7gr58m6942snkg9fr
transaction
ed8610651575cc38ca9e53dcff490d3b71112f778a4b66f69f00e9f9ae6a0ee0
confirmations
174113
spent
true